Output 523fe3451319802ffb0ee158225588a7301aa63506a1504174851de7498b48f7:161

value
1334040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2744ef3e0f97672a31646b9b69dc7cf52371169 OP_EQUAL
address
3KRCM1TmCztDpCPtdZHihyMZpLKiDF4dQC
transaction
523fe3451319802ffb0ee158225588a7301aa63506a1504174851de7498b48f7
spent
true